Databricks Unity Catalog AI Capabilities & Performance Evidence

Core AI Functionality

Unity Catalog's AI capabilities include automated documentation generation and semantic search across technical metadata, enhancing data discoverability and reducing manual effort [40][41][46]. The platform's feature store integration allows AI designers to publish, discover, and monitor features directly within the governance framework, eliminating synchronization overhead [41][45].

Performance Validation

Customer implementations, such as Block's, report significant reductions in compute costs and data transfer expenses through optimized data placement and access controls [53]. Kubrick Group's deployment for an FMCG retailer achieved faster data discovery and enabled new machine learning use cases previously hindered by access limitations [49].

Implementation Experiences

Deploying Unity Catalog requires careful planning across metastore architecture, managed storage configuration, and privilege model alignment with existing ANSI SQL permissions [43][57]. Implementation timelines vary, with basic MVP deployments taking 4-10 weeks and comprehensive implementations extending to 6-12 months [56].

Databricks Unity Catalog Pricing & Commercial Considerations

Investment Analysis

Unity Catalog's pricing structure reflects its infrastructure positioning, with metadata storage costs complementing compute DBU pricing. This creates a TCO profile optimized for large-scale deployments rather than departmental implementations [58][59].

ROI Evidence

Documented ROI cases demonstrate compelling value, with organizations like Block achieving compute cost reductions and lower data egress fees [53]. Break-even analysis shows 6-9 month payback periods for organizations with over 50 data producers [49][53][58].

Budget Fit Assessment

Unity Catalog delivers the strongest ROI when replacing multiple point solutions, making it a suitable choice for large enterprises with complex data governance needs. SMBs may require longer to realize full value due to higher absolute costs [58].

Success Enablers

Key success factors include executive sponsorship, phased feature rollout, and dedicated governance liaison roles. Organizations should avoid "big bang" migrations and instead use pilot groups before enterprise rollout [49][52][53].
